Transaction d937762529722fda6697e78479f0779880542961165683b63d268dfbfe34b698
1 Input
1 Output
-
d937762529722fda6697e78479f0779880542961165683b63d268dfbfe34b698:0
- value
- 649647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8ddb9018fa35baeade4b87f64fcedbf486de9d9 OP_EQUAL
- address
- 3QNu7gNPCT8G4aJCCkew2h8VuBQsH4DQKi